Ubuntu VPN mit Sonicwall


12

Das einzige, was mich davon abhält, die beschissene Vista-Installation auf meinem Toshiba-Laptop wegzublasen und Ubuntu pur zu machen, ist die Tatsache, dass ich VPN brauche, um zu funktionieren, und dass sie Sonicwall verwenden. Aufgrund von proprietärem Voodoo, das von diesem speziellen Firewall-Setup bei meiner Arbeit verwendet wird, muss ich den Sonicwall-Client verwenden, der nur unter Windows ausgeführt wird.

Hat jemand eine Möglichkeit gefunden, von Ubuntu aus eine VPN-Verbindung zu einer Sonicwall herzustellen?


Antworten:


7
  1. Gehen Sie zu https://sslvpn.demo.sonicwall.com/cgi-bin/welcome und melden Sie sich mit an demo/password

  2. Klicken Sie auf das NetExtender-Symbol: Dadurch wird ein tar.gz mit dem Client heruntergeladen.

  3. (Optional) sudo ln -s /lib/x86_64-linux-gnu/libssl.so.1.0.0 /usr/lib/libssl.so.6

  4. (Optional) sudo ln -s /lib/x86_64-linux-gnu/libcrypto.so.1.0.0 /usr/lib/libcrypto.so.6

  5. Entpacken Sie den Client, machen Sie das Installationsskript ausführbar (chmod u + x) und starten Sie die Installation

Hinweis : Lassen Sie beim Ausführen des Installationsskripts keinen Root-Zugriff zu

sudo ./install

--- Dell SonicWALL NetExtender 7.5.761 Installer ---
Checking library dependencies...
Checking pppd...
Do you want non-root users to be able to run NetExtender?
    If so, I can set pppd to run as root, but this could be
    considered a security risk.

Set pppd to run as root [y/N]? N
You have chosen NOT to allow non-root users to run NetExtender.
Copying files...

------------------------ INSTALLATION SUCCESSFUL -----------------------

Führen Sie einen der folgenden Schritte aus, um NetExtender zu starten:

  1. Klicken Sie im Anwendungsmenü auf das NetExtender-Symbol (siehe Kategorie "Internet" oder "Netzwerk") oder
  2. Art netExtenderGui

Getestete Lösung von Ubuntu 13 bis 18.04.


Für 14.04 waren die obigen Schritte 3 und 4 nicht erforderlich. Laden Sie einfach das Installationsprogramm herunter und führen Sie es aus.
Shaun Dychko

1
Dies ist nur für SSL VPN
Sander Visser

Bestätigen funktioniert super, ich bestätige, dass die Schritte 3 und 4 am 18.04 nicht benötigt werden. Sie müssen außerdem sicherstellen, dass Java installiert ist, wenn Sie die grafische
Benutzeroberfläche verwenden möchten

4

nicht unbedingt die beste Quelle, aber es scheint, dass Sie dies mit OpenSwan VPN unter Linux tun können.

Es ist keine triviale Einrichtung, ein paar Kontrollkästchen anzuklicken, aber es scheint machbar.

http://www.pelagodesign.com/blog/2009/05/18/ubuntu-linux-anweisungen-zum-Einrichten-a-vpn-Verbindung-zum-Schallwandrouter-mit-openswan-und-vorbereitenden- shared-keys-psk /

ODER

http://ubuntuforums.org/showthread.php?t=527423

zwischen diesen beiden Artikeln solltest du etwas herausfinden können.


0

Ja, es gibt einen Sonicwall NetExtender-Client, der von der SonicWalls-Website heruntergeladen werden kann. Ich benutze es die ganze Zeit. Nach der Installation geben Sie netExtender (Groß- und Kleinschreibung beachten) in die Befehlszeile ein und Sie werden aufgefordert, Ihre creds einzugeben.


0

Ich auch, jetzt die gleiche Bühne. Ich habe OpenSwan VPN nicht ausprobiert. Wie auch immer, Net Extender wird in meinem Fall nicht helfen. Meines Wissens nach müssen wir NetExtender im Sonicwall-Gerät konfigurieren, um den NetExtender-Client verwenden zu können


0

Es gibt einen offiziellen Knowledge Base - Artikel von Sonicwall hier die für Linux - Installation durch die einzelnen Schritte geht. Sie besprechen sowohl die GUI- als auch die Befehlszeilenverwendung des netExtenderProgramms nach der Installation. Letzteres ist hilfreich, da Sie keine zusätzlichen Java-Abhängigkeiten für die GUI installieren müssen

Die einzige Ungenauigkeit, die mir im Artikel aufgefallen ist, ist, dass für NetExtender keine Schaltfläche "Verfeinern nach" ausgewählt werden kann. Stattdessen müssen Sie mit "Global Vpn Client (32-Bit)" auf die Dropdown-Liste klicken.

Durch die Nutzung unserer Website bestätigen Sie, dass Sie unsere Cookie-Richtlinie und Datenschutzrichtlinie gelesen und verstanden haben.
Licensed under cc by-sa 3.0 with attribution required.